a graph shows y=x^2 translate to graph y=(x-5)^2

Move the vertex of the parabola 5 units to the right. Because if you have x^2, then you would only have to plug in 0 to make the y=0.  But if you have (x-5)^2, to make y=0, you need x to equal 5.
